Castro del Cuerno de Bezana
Castro del Cuerno de Bezana is an archaeological site in Valle de Valdebezana, Province of Burgos, Castile and León. Castro del Cuerno de Bezana is situated nearby to the peak Pico Nava, as well as near the church Cueva de La Tía Isidora.Places in the Area
Nearby places include Arnedo de Valdebezana and Herbosa.
